Insight on Selling Price and Where to Sell
I'm really leaning towards possibly taking advantage of a job opp that requires moving the family. Curious, on what price I should expect to sell my 17 M6 GC? Its Sakhir Orange with all options. Had some one scam me out of 10k on ebay so there is no way in...that I'd list it there. Any recommendations on where to list it? She has almost 16k miles and is garage kept. No after market items.

I'm guessing best estimate is to go on cars/autotrader and price a comparable car for year and mileage and condition from any dealer (independent or BMW) Then you can knock off $5-$7k or so to list price for the low end of a private deal. The high end is likely the list price of that car.
Where to post? Hard to say, but should be nationwide for a car with low volumes. Post on those sites, and if you have a special car, post on enthusiast forums like this or local BMW group pages on Facebook
